Cross-Platform 3D Scanning for Trackers and Measuring Arms
The Hexagon Absolute Scanner AS1 is a high-speed blue laser 3D scanner designed for the Leica Absolute Tracker AT960 and Absolute Arm 7-Axis. Its modular cross-platform design allows the same scanner to perform non-contact dimensional inspection with either system, with no realignment required when switching between tracker and arm measurement.
Hexagon’s SHINE technology automatically manages measurement noise across a wide range of materials and surface finishes. The scanner maintains its full frame rate and scan-line width without hidden performance settings that reduce scanning speed to achieve accurate results.
An extra-wide horizontal laser line and automatic exposure control help operators capture detailed 3D measurement data quickly and consistently. This combination makes the AS1 suitable for quality inspection, reverse engineering and manual or automated manufacturing applications.

Repeatable Mounting and Automation-Ready Inspection
The Absolute Scanner AS1 features a repeatable quick-release mounting system that allows it to be transferred between compatible measurement devices. When used with the Absolute Arm 7-Axis, removing the scanner also provides easier access for touch probing in difficult-to-reach areas. The AS1 can then be remounted without recalibration, allowing 3D scanning to continue immediately.
For laser tracker measurement, the AS1 is paired with the Absolute Positioner AP21, which provides the 6DoF referencing required for large-scale inspection. This configuration delivers measurement accuracy within 50 microns across a 60-metre-diameter measurement volume, reaching up to 30 metres from the Absolute Tracker.
The AS1 can also be integrated into automated laser tracker inspection systems. Its high-speed data capture supports modern robotic workflows, while the scanner’s large standoff distance helps reduce collision risk. This flexibility makes it a portable metrology scanner for manual and automated quality inspection of components across different sizes and applications.

Features and Benefits of the Absolute Scanner AS1
Large-Scale Accuracy
When used with an Absolute Tracker, the AS1 delivers measurement accuracy within 50 microns across the complete 60-metre-diameter measurement volume.
Smaller-Scale Precision
The AS1 and Absolute Arm configuration delivers complete scanning system accuracy within 39 microns for precise dimensional inspection.
Low-Noise, High-Density Data
Capture up to 1.2 million high-quality measurement points per second, including on reflective surfaces that may require scanning spray with other systems.
High-Speed Measurement
Digitise large surfaces at up to 300 scan lines per second without reducing the laser line width or point spacing.
150 mm Scan Line
The extra-wide 150 mm scan line at mid-range covers more surface area with each pass, accelerating the digitisation of components and surfaces.
SHINE Performance
Systematic High-Intelligence Noise Elimination technology supports reliable scanning with default exposure settings across varied surfaces, from glossy black plastics to moulded carbon-fibre components. This simplifies operation and reduces operator variability.
Ease of Use
Operators can switch measurement profiles, run macros and access software functions using the AP21 programmable Quick Access buttons or the Absolute Arm OLED touchscreen wrist display.
Lightweight Movement
Weighing only 400 grams, the AS1 is easy to manoeuvre and helps reduce operator fatigue during extended inspection tasks.
Portable Controller
The scanner’s lightweight design extends to its controller, which can be mounted directly on the tracker stand for a compact and portable measurement setup.
Visual Guidance
A laser-projected range finder helps operators maintain the correct scanner position relative to the measured surface for efficient and consistent data capture.
Automation Ready
Integrated digital input and output enables robot movement and scanning tasks to be managed without a separate automation interface in laser tracker automation setups.
Modular Design
The modular AS1 design supports efficient servicing and allows the scanner to be shared between compatible measurement systems, teams and locations.
Cross-Platform Compatibility
Use the AS1 with the handheld Absolute Positioner AP21 and an Absolute Tracker for large-volume measurement, or mount it on an Absolute Arm 7-Axis for smaller-scale inspection. No realignment is required when switching platforms.
ISO Certification
The AS1 and Absolute Arm 7-Axis system is supplied with scanning system accuracy certified according to ISO 10360-8 Annex D. The AS1 with the AP21 is specified in accordance with ISO 10360-10.
